Transaction d7be099952bb68e92f284c0213046d1b27296bc7343a4bed3572fe3286c63c18

block
19819d70e73d6d1ac221f5b200d0cd710c7b9772267c1ee132c764a60b89f6d3

660 Inputs

2 Outputs